What makes Pleasanton a distinctive solar market
Pleasanton property owners are not going shopping in a vacuum cleaner. Regional housing supply varies more than lots of people realize. Some neighborhoods have huge, newer roofs with generous south and west exposures. Others have aging structure roof shingles, more color from mature trees, or layouts separated by hips, ridges, and vents. That issues because the very best installer is not always the one with the flashiest proposition. It is usually the one that notifications roofing restrictions early and readjusts the style accordingly.
The energy setting matters also. The golden state solar business economics have altered in the last few years, specifically for homes offered by PG&E. Exporting excess power back to the grid is generally much less important than it when was, so layout strategy now matters much more. An oversized system might https://juliuslbag464.iamarrows.com/leading-solar-installers-in-pleasanton-just-how-to-pick-the-best-solar-installation-firm-near-you not give you the return you expect. A right-sized system coupled with tons moving, or in many cases a battery, can do better monetarily also if the price tag is higher.
Pleasanton also gets plenty of sunlight, however house owners must not deal with every roofing system as equal. Summertime production can look fantastic on paper. Winter season production, early morning color, chimney blockages, and roof pitch can quietly reshape yearly output. Experienced local installers generally speak in terms of annual manufacturing estimates, balance out targets, and time-of-use patterns, not simply panel count.
The installer matters as long as the equipment
Many customers start with equipment brands. They ask which panel is best, whether microinverters are far better than string inverters, or whether a battery brand is much more dependable. Those are fair inquiries, but they commonly come also early.
A well-installed system with solid mid-to-upper-tier devices usually surpasses an inadequately designed system constructed with costs parts. I have actually seen beautifully marketed proposals that overlooked afternoon color, positioned components also near roofing sides, or advised a panel format that would certainly make complex future roofing system job. On paper, those systems looked outstanding. In technique, they developed frustration.
A reputable installer makes trust in quieter means. They inspect the major service panel instead of assuming compatibility. They ask about prepared electric lorry billing, heatpump upgrades, and pool devices. They mention roofing system age prior to you need to bring it up. They explain why one area of roofing is productive and one more is not. They inform you when a battery deserves thinking about and when it might not pencil out yet.
That kind of judgment is what separates a sales operation from an actual installation company.

Start with your very own residence, not the sales pitch
Before comparing installers, take stock of your home. The cleaner your starting info, the less complicated it is to assess propositions fairly.
Look at the last one year of electrical bills if you can. That smooths out seasonal swings and gives the installer a reasonable annual usage number. If your use is transforming, note why. An inbound EV, a planned jacuzzi, or a button from gas devices to electric can have a larger impact than a panel effectiveness difference between brands.
Next, check out your roofing with a functional eye. If it is nearing completion of its service life, solar may still make sense, yet reroofing before installment is typically the better economic selection. Eliminating and re-installing panels later on costs money and includes inconvenience. Excellent service providers bring this up early since they understand property owners resent being amazed by it.
Shade is entitled to truthful therapy as well. A little color is not always an offer breaker. The concern is whether your installer procedures and designs it properly. Fully grown trees on bordering whole lots, particularly in well-known Pleasanton communities, can impact manufacturing more than satellite images suggests.
Questions that reveal whether a firm knows its craft
You do not require to interrogate every salesperson, but a couple of concentrated inquiries can inform you a great deal. Ask who will in fact set up the system. Some firms sell under one brand and subcontract most area work. That does not instantly imply low quality, yet it does change liability. Ask what happens if there is a roofing system leakage, an inverter failure, or an interconnection delay. Pay attention to whether the responses are direct or evasive.
Ask just how they size systems under existing utility payment policies. A knowledgeable installer should describe why countering one hundred percent of annual use is not constantly the evident target anymore. They must talk about use timing, export value, and whether battery storage space alters the calculation.
Ask what presumptions they made regarding your roofing system and electric panel. If they can not respond to plainly, that is an indication. The very best propositions are not just polished PDFs. They are based in actual website conditions.
One of the most revealing inquiries is basic: what might complicate this project? Great companies always have a solution. Maybe your floor tile roofing system needs added care. Perhaps your main panel is crowded. Perhaps your attic access is limited. Maybe your preferred panel format bumps versus fire trouble regulations. Candor right here is a positive indicator. Every home has some constraint.
Red flags property owners must take seriously
Some indication are refined, others are not. If a depictive pushes you to sign before examining your real use, that is a trouble. If the proposition shows round, suspiciously cool financial savings numbers without discussing rate presumptions, beware. If every inquiry concerning batteries, panels, and inverters in some way leads back to a limited-time discount rate, you are not obtaining advice, you are obtaining pressure.
Watch for obscure warranties too. Many customers hear "25-year warranty" and presume it covers whatever. It typically does not. There may be separate product, performance, and workmanship warranties, all with different terms and various parties responsible. An experienced installer explains who manages what, and just how solution asserts actually work.
Another issue is impractical timing. Permits, energy approvals, evaluations, and periodic tools backorders can all impact the routine. Business that promise an implausibly quick turn-around often develop dissatisfaction later. Accuracy matters more than rate in these conversations.
Here are a couple of red flags worth bearing in mind:
- A quote that is far less than every competitor without a clear explanation
- No website go to or no purposeful assessment prior to the contract
- Pressure to authorize right away to "lock in" an unclear incentive
- Evasive responses about subcontractors, warranty solution, or panel upgrades
- Production estimates that appear separated from roofing positioning or color conditions
None of these immediately eliminates a bargain, but every one deserves scrutiny.
Price matters, yet quote framework matters more
Homeowners normally contrast bottom-line numbers initially. That is easy to understand, however solar quotes usually conceal significant differences in scope.
One business might consist of major panel job while another omits it. One might presume attic conduit runs while one more strategies exterior conduit. One may consist of intake monitoring while another does not. One may make use of premium all-black components that look better from the street but expense more per watt. One more might recommend an easier design with a little higher manufacturing and much less visual symmetry. If you compare only the contract total amount, you might miss the reason for the spread.
Cost per watt serves, but not enough. So is predicted annual production, but only if the assumptions are reputable. Funding terms matter as well. A reduced monthly settlement can disguise a higher overall system cost, particularly if supplier fees are rolled right into the financing.
When I examine quotes with homeowners, I typically inform them to compare four points at once: complete price, equipment high quality, manufacturing logic, and the installer's determination to describe compromises. The least expensive quote wins less often than people expect when all four are taken into consideration together.
Why batteries get in the discussion regularly now
In Pleasanton, battery storage is no more a fringe add-on. It is becoming part of mainstream solar planning, particularly for home owners concerned about night rates, backup power, or future flexibility.
That stated, batteries are not automatically the right selection. They add considerable price. For some homes, the economics are still minimal if the primary objective is bill cost savings alone. For others, especially homes with high night usage or a strong wish for blackout durability, a battery may make sense earlier instead of later.
A trustworthy installer need to have the ability to review this without pressing one answer. They should ask what you desire the battery to do. Do you wish to support the entire house, or just a few critical tons like refrigeration, internet, some lights, and garage accessibility? Do you desire costs arbitrage, resilience, or both? The response changes system design.
It deserves keeping in mind that "battery-ready" can indicate various points. In some cases it suggests the electric layout will certainly make a later battery addition simpler. Occasionally it is mostly sales language. Ask what would really require to transform if you include storage in 2 years.
The importance of roofing and electric judgment
Many jobs go laterally not as a result of the panels, yet due to the house below them. Roof problem and electrical capacity are the two largest hidden variables.
A firm with actual area experience does not deal with an older roof covering delicately. Structure shingle roofings nearing end of life, brittle ceramic tiles, or roof coverings with past leakage history should have an even more cautious conversation. A salesman concentrated just on closing the deal might wave those concerns away. An experienced installer understands that every roofing system penetration, every add-on factor, and every solution check out later depends upon the roof being audio now.
Electrical solution is just as important. Some Pleasanton homes have older panels or minimal busbar ability. Others might already bring additional tons from EV chargers, jacuzzis, or redesigned cooking areas. Solar integration can be simple, but just when the existing system can support it or when upgrade needs are determined in advance.
This is one reason regional recommendations matter. A business that has functioned repeatedly in the location typically acknowledges typical panel kinds, roof covering styles, and neighborhood-specific restraints much faster than a company that operates generally yet thinly.
Reviews assist, yet just if you review them correctly
Online testimonials serve, though not in the way most people believe. An ideal celebrity ranking alone informs you really bit. Rather, check out for patterns.
Look for comments about communication after the agreement is authorized. That stage is where weaker companies frequently stumble. Sales groups can be brightened, but project coordination discloses the real organization. See whether customers state delays, modification orders, examination concerns, or difficulty obtaining service later.
Pay attention to just how evaluations define problem resolution. No installer has a perfect record for life. Devices stops working. Timetables slip. Roofing contractors and electrical experts sometimes uncover shocks. The significant question is whether the company had the problem and fixed it responsibly.
If you can, ask next-door neighbors about their experience directly. Pleasanton property owners are typically candid about professionals, especially when asked specific questions like whether the staff took care, whether the project supervisor communicated well, and whether the last system executed close to expectations.

Frequently Ask Questions about Solar Installers in Pleasanton, CA
What does the average solar installation cost in Pleasanton?
The average residential solar installation typically costs between $15,000 and $30,000 before incentives. The final cost depends on system size, equipment quality, roof characteristics, and installation complexity. Federal tax credits and other incentives can reduce the upfront expense. Homes with higher electricity usage generally require larger systems.
Who is the best company to install solar panels in Pleasanton?
The best solar installer depends on factors such as licensing, certifications, customer reviews, equipment options, and warranty coverage. Comparing multiple quotes helps evaluate system design and pricing. A qualified installer should assess your home's energy needs and roof condition. Installation quality and long-term support are also important considerations.
Why is my electric bill high if I have solar in Pleasanton?
An electric bill may remain high if your solar system does not produce enough electricity to offset your energy use. Seasonal weather changes, increased electricity consumption, and utility fees can also affect monthly bills. Shading, equipment issues, or dirty panels may reduce energy production. Reviewing system performance and household energy usage can help identify the cause.
Can AC run on solar panels in Pleasanton?
Yes, an air conditioner can run on electricity generated by solar panels when the system is properly sized. Cooling demand is often highest during sunny periods when solar production is also at its peak. Battery storage or grid electricity can provide additional power when solar output is lower. Energy-efficient air conditioners help reduce electricity consumption.
How much is a solar system for a 2000 sq ft house in Pleasanton?
A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home typically costs between $18,000 and $30,000 before incentives. The required system size depends primarily on electricity usage rather than the home's square footage. Roof orientation, shading, and panel efficiency also influence the final cost. Available incentives can significantly lower the upfront investment.
Is solar worth it financially in Pleasanton?
Solar can provide long-term financial benefits by reducing electricity costs over time. The overall value depends on installation costs, available incentives, household energy usage, and future utility rates. Many homeowners recover their investment through years of lower energy bills. Individual savings vary based on system performance and electricity consumption.
What are the disadvantages of solar panels in Pleasanton?
Solar panels require a significant upfront investment and may not be suitable for every roof. Electricity production decreases during cloudy weather and stops at night without battery storage. Roof repairs may require temporary panel removal. Some equipment, such as inverters, may need replacement before the panels reach the end of their lifespan.
Can 1 solar panel power a whole house in Pleasanton?
No, a single solar panel cannot generate enough electricity to power an entire house. Most homes require multiple panels working together to meet daily energy needs. The exact number depends on electricity usage, panel output, and available sunlight. Larger households generally require larger solar systems.
Do you really save money installing solar panels in Pleasanton?
Many homeowners save money over the long term by reducing the amount of electricity purchased from the utility. The total savings depend on installation costs, system performance, available incentives, and future electricity rates. Higher household energy use can increase potential savings. Results vary based on individual energy consumption and system design.
How long do solar panels typically last in Pleasanton?
Most solar panels have an expected lifespan of 25 to 30 years. Although efficiency gradually declines over time, panels often continue producing electricity beyond their warranty period. Regular maintenance helps maintain long-term performance. Inverters typically require replacement after about 10 to 15 years.
